Abstract

It is necessary to allocate sufficient surplus resources to each service in order to maintain a service level of each service, but, as a result, many resources which are not used may be necessary. A resource allocation optimizing system performs, with respect to each of a plurality of services, a predictive judgement which is a determination of whether or not accurate prediction of a workload of the service is able to be anticipated, and controls allocation of a resource to the service on the basis of a result of the predictive judgement. With respect to each service, the predictive judgement is performed on the basis of at least one of (x) time-series measured workloads and time-series predicted workloads in a predefined period for the service and (y) at least one of a measured service level and a predicted service level in the predefined period for the service.
